Section 01

Neighborhood Overview

Reginald F. Lewis High School is situated in the Pimlico neighborhood of Baltimore, a mid-sized urban area known for its mix of residential streets and community facilities. The school is easily accessible via major thoroughfares like Northern Parkway and Pimlico Road, which connect to larger arteries such as I-83. For those arriving from further afield, Baltimore/Washington International Thurgood Marshall Airport (BWI) is approximately a 30-45 minute drive, depending on traffic, and offers extensive flight options. Public transportation is available; the Maryland Transit Administration (MTA) operates bus routes that serve the area, providing connections to downtown Baltimore and other city districts. Rideshare services are also a common and convenient option for navigating within the city. Planning your arrival about 30-45 minutes before an event is advisable to account for local traffic, especially during school drop-off/pick-up times or for larger community gatherings. Familiarize yourself with the specific parking areas designated for your event to streamline your entry.

Section 08

Weather & Seasons

❄️

Winter

Winter in Baltimore typically brings cold weather, with average temperatures ranging from the low 20s to the low 40s Fahrenheit. Visitors should pack heavy coats, gloves, hats, and warm layers. Snowfall is possible, which can impact travel times and outdoor event comfort. Indoor activities and venues are often preferred during the coldest months. Ensure your footwear is suitable for potentially icy or snowy conditions.

🌱

Spring & early summer

Spring and early summer bring mild to warm temperatures, averaging from the 50s to the 70s Fahrenheit. Light jackets or sweaters are useful for cooler mornings and evenings. This is a prime time for outdoor events, but occasional rain showers are frequent, so carrying an umbrella or light rain gear is advisable. Comfortable walking shoes are recommended for exploring.

☀️

Mid-summer

Mid-summer, from June through August, is characterized by heat and humidity, with temperatures often in the 80s and 90s Fahrenheit. Light, breathable clothing is essential. Staying hydrated is crucial, especially for outdoor activities. Sunscreen and hats are recommended to protect against strong sun exposure. Evening events are more comfortable as temperatures begin to drop slightly.

🍂

Fall season

Fall brings crisp, pleasant weather, with temperatures gradually cooling from the 60s to the 40s Fahrenheit. This season is ideal for outdoor events and exploring the city. Layers are key, as mornings can be cool and afternoons mild. Comfortable walking shoes are a must for enjoying the autumn air and potential park visits. The changing foliage adds scenic beauty to the area.

📅

Rain & snow

Baltimore experiences regular rainfall throughout the year, with heavier periods often occurring in spring and summer. Snow is possible during winter months, though significant accumulations can vary annually. Always check local weather forecasts before traveling, as precipitation can affect outdoor plans and transportation. Having a compact umbrella or raincoat is a practical addition to your packing list for most times of the year.
